What is Z?

⅓ (z + 4) - 6 = ⅔ (5 - z)

Answer:

z = 8

Step-by-step explanation:

⅓(z+4)-6 = ⅔(5-z)

multiply both part of the equation by 3

3×⅓(z+4)- 3×6 = 3×⅔(5-z)

z + 4 -18 = 2(5-z)

z-14 =10-2z

grouping like terms

z+2z =10+14

3z = 24

Now, divide both side of the equation(3z=24) by 3

3z/3 = 24/3

z =8
